Abstract

The invention discloses a learning monitoring system, comprising: monitoring a mother lamp and at least one learning child lamp; wherein: the learning sub-lamp includes: the camera module is used for shooting a learning condition picture of a person under guardianship in a specified learning area in real time; the information sharing module is used for sharing the learning condition picture to the monitoring mother lamp when receiving a viewing request of the monitoring mother lamp; the monitoring mother lamp includes: the instruction receiving and sending module is used for receiving a checking instruction sent by a guardian and sending a checking request to the learning sub-lamp; the information acquisition module is used for receiving a learning condition picture shared by the learning sub-lamps; and the projection module is used for projecting the learning condition picture so as to be convenient for the guardian to check. In addition, the invention also discloses a learning monitoring method, which is applied to the learning monitoring system. By the invention, parents can effectively supervise the learning condition of children and can cultivate the independent learning ability and habit of children.

Background
Learning education is the most concerned of many parents, and the learning habit of independent learning, good learning ability are that every parent hopes that children can possess. However, in practice, due to the insecurity of parents and the dependence of children, parents often need to monitor aside during the learning process of doing homework, and the "monitoring" of parents often affects the learning efficiency of children and even the relationship between parents and children.
To foster the ability of children to do work and study independently, parents choose to let their hands free, rather than accompany their reading sideways. When the children are independently studied in one room, parents worry about whether the children really study or not, the children can be distracted and worry about the study in the study process, and the study thought of the children is interrupted if the children frequently enter the room to look over and worry about the disturbance of the study of the children. Parents cannot effectively supervise the learning of children without affecting the children.

Fig. 1 shows an embodiment of a learning monitoring system of the present invention, and specifically, the learning monitoring system in this embodiment includes: monitoring the mother lamp 200 and the at least one learning child lamp 100; learning sub-lamp 100 and female lamp 200 of monitoring are all intelligent desk lamp, carry out the interaction through communication connection between learning sub-lamp 100 and the female lamp 200 of monitoring, learning sub-lamp 100 generally gives child (by guardianship) use, female lamp 200 of monitoring generally gives the head of a family (guardian) use, learning sub-lamp 100 sets up in the room of difference with the female lamp of monitoring, except possessing ordinary illumination function, learning sub-lamp 100 still possesses the function of taking in real time and sharing child's study condition, female lamp 200 of monitoring still possesses the study condition picture of sharing the learning sub-lamp and carries out the projection show, the function that the head of a family looked over, with the confession. Specifically, the learning sub-lamp 100 specifically includes:
the camera module 110 is used for shooting a learning condition picture of a person under guardianship in a designated learning area in real time;
specifically, the learning sub-lamp 100 is generally used for learning of a child (a person under guardianship), and a camera is mounted on the learning sub-lamp 100, so that the learning condition of the person under guardianship can be monitored in real time through the camera, and a picture of learning of the person under guardianship in a specified learning area is taken.
The information sharing module 120 is configured to share the learning condition picture with the monitoring mother lamp 200 when receiving a viewing request of the monitoring mother lamp 200;
specifically, when the learning sub-lamp 100 receives the viewing request sent by the monitoring main lamp 200, the monitored learning condition picture is synchronously shared with the monitoring main lamp 200, so that parents (guardians) can view the current learning condition of children (guardians).
The monitoring mother lamp 200 includes:
the instruction transceiver module 210 is configured to receive a viewing instruction sent by a guardian, and send a viewing request to the learning sub-lamp 100;
specifically, the mother light 200 is generally used by a parent (guardian), and the parent can monitor the learning condition of the child in another room (for example, the child does work under the child light 100) by monitoring the mother light 200. When a parent wants to check the current learning condition of a child and is afraid of disturbing the learning of the child, the parent can input a checking instruction on the monitoring parent lamp 200, and after receiving the checking instruction, the instruction transceiver module 210 of the monitoring parent lamp 200 sends a checking request to the learning child lamp 100.
An information obtaining module 220, configured to receive the learning condition picture shared by the learning sub-lamps 100;
specifically, after the learning sub-lamp 100 receives the viewing request sent by the monitoring main lamp 200, the photographed learning condition picture is synchronously shared with the monitoring main lamp 200, and the information acquisition module 220 of the monitoring main lamp 200 receives the learning condition picture.
The projection module 230 is configured to project the learning situation picture for the guardian to view conveniently.
Specifically, after the monitoring mother lamp 200 receives the learning condition picture shared by the learning child lamps 100, the learning condition picture is projected for the convenience of parents to check, the parents can see the current learning condition of the child, and the child does not need to run to the room price of the child to check, so that the learning efficiency of the child is not disturbed.
The learning monitoring system of the embodiment comprises a monitoring mother lamp 200 and at least one learning sub lamp 100, and the learning condition of a corresponding child monitored by any learning sub lamp 100 in the system can be checked through the monitoring mother lamp 200. The learning sub-lamp 100 is generally used by a person under guardianship, and the monitoring main lamp 200 is used by a guardian. To foster the ability of children to do work and study independently, parents choose to let their hands free, rather than accompany their reading sideways. When the children are independently study in one room, parents worry about whether the children really study or not, frequently go into the room to check and worry about disturbing the study of the children, and the study thought of the children is interrupted. The learning monitoring system effectively solves the problem that when a child works in a study room, the learning condition of the child can be shot in real time by the learning sub-lamp 100, and a parent can check the current learning condition of the child at any time by monitoring the parent lamp 200 in another room, so that the learning of the child is not influenced, and the parent can know whether the child is really doing the writing operation currently. For a family with multiple children, the learning conditions of the children can be acquired through the learning sub-lamps 100, and parents can select to switch to view the learning pictures of the corresponding children at the monitoring main lamp 200.
In this embodiment, the learning condition of the child is monitored by the learning sub-lamp 100, the learning condition picture of the child is shot, and when the viewing request sent by the parent through the monitoring parent lamp 200 is received, the picture of the learning condition of the child is shared by the monitoring parent lamp 200 for the parent to view. Therefore, parents can effectively supervise the learning condition of children and can cultivate the independent learning ability and habit of the children.
In another embodiment of the system of the present invention, based on the above embodiment, the learning sub-lamp 100 is added with an abnormality monitoring function, specifically, the learning monitoring system of this embodiment is shown in fig. 2, where the learning sub-lamp 100 further includes:
an anomaly monitoring module 130, configured to analyze the learning condition picture and detect whether the person under guardianship learns;
specifically, the abnormality monitoring module 130 may detect whether the person under guardianship is learning by analyzing the learning condition picture. Such as detecting a child sleeping, playing a toy, etc. Of course, it is necessary to perform image processing after the captured learning situation picture, recognize the behavior of the person under guardianship, and determine whether the person under guardianship is learning.
The information sharing module 120 is further configured to share the learning condition picture with the monitoring mother lamp 200 when it is detected that the person under guardianship is not learning.
Specifically, when the anomaly monitoring module 130 detects that the monitored person is not learning, the learning condition picture is shared with the monitoring mother lamp 200, so that the monitor can know the condition in time.
In the learning monitoring system of this embodiment, the learning sub-lamp 100 can analyze the photographed learning condition picture, detect whether child is learning at present, in case it is not learning at present to detect child, for example when sleeping or playing toys etc., the synchronous analysis of the photographed learning condition picture is given to the monitoring mother lamp 200, so that parents can know in time, and child is reminded in time to learn carefully.
Preferably, when it is monitored that the child is not learning the abnormal behavior, the information sharing module 120 further sends an abnormal alarm to the monitoring mother lamp 200 to remind the guardian to timely stop the non-learning behavior of the child.
Alternatively, the learning sub-lamp further comprises: and the reminding module is used for sending out voice reminding to remind the person under guardianship to learn when detecting that the person under guardianship is not learning. Therefore, when the learning sub-lamp monitors that the child is not learning at present, but playing or sleeping, the learning sub-lamp can actively give out voice prompt to enable the child to get back to the learning state in time, help the child change the bad habit of not paying attention to learning, and improve the learning efficiency.
In another embodiment of the system of the present invention, as shown in fig. 3, on the basis of any of the above embodiments, the learning sub-lamp 100 further includes:
the learning statistic module 140 is configured to, when the person under guardianship finishes learning, obtain learning content and learning duration of the person under guardianship according to the learning condition picture;
specifically, when the person under guardianship finishes the current learning, the learning statistic module 140 obtains the learning content and the learning duration of the person under guardianship according to the previously monitored learning condition. For example, the person under guardianship does mathematical operation at 17: 00-17: 50 for 50 minutes in total; and performing English operation at a ratio of 18: 00-18: 30 for 30 minutes in total.
A report generation module 150, configured to generate a learning report according to the learning content and the learning duration of the person under guardianship;
specifically, after the learning content and the learning duration of the person under guardianship are acquired, a learning report is generated accordingly, the learning content and the learning duration of the person under guardianship are reflected on the learning report, and preferably, some learning suggestions are given.
The information sharing module 120 is further configured to send the learning report to the monitoring mother lamp 200 for a guardian to view.
Specifically, after the report generating module 150 generates the learning report, the information sharing module 120 sends the learning report to the monitoring mother lamp 200 for the guardian to view.
In the learning monitoring system of this embodiment, the learning sub-lamp 100 can also count the learning content and the learning duration of the child learning this time, and generate the corresponding learning report and send to the monitoring mother lamp 200, so that the parents can know that the child learning this time has an overall understanding.
In another embodiment of the system of the present invention, on the basis of any of the above embodiments, the learning sub-lamp is added with a help request function, specifically, the learning monitoring system of this embodiment is shown in fig. 4, and the learning sub-lamp 100 further includes:
and the help request module 160 is configured to receive a help request instruction sent by the monitored person, and send a help request to the monitoring mother lamp 200.
Specifically, the learning sub-lamp 100 in this embodiment further has a function of seeking help, for example, when a child is in the learning process, a difficult problem cannot be solved, and a parent's help is sought, the help seeking function of the learning sub-lamp 100 is started, the help requesting module 160 sends a help seeking request to the monitoring main lamp 200 after receiving a help requesting instruction from the child, and the monitoring main lamp 200 receives the help seeking request and notifies a guardian of the help seeking request, so that the guardian knows that the child needs help, and the notification may be performed in various manners, for example, the monitoring main lamp 200 may be in a form of flashing light, a form of voice broadcast, a form of alarm, or a manner of projecting a help seeking icon, and the like.
In another embodiment of the system of the present invention, as shown in fig. 4, on the basis of any one of the above embodiments of the system, the monitoring mother lamp 200 further includes:
a voice obtaining module 240, configured to obtain a prompting voice of a guardian when the instruction transceiver module 210 receives a prompting instruction, and send the prompting voice to the learning sub-lamp 100;
specifically, when the guardian views the learning condition picture of the child at the monitoring mother lamp 200, if the condition that the child does not learn seriously and opens little or bad thought and the like is found, the guardian can also send a prompt to the child. The voice acquiring module 240 monitoring the mother lamp 200 may acquire a reminding voice of the user and then transmit the reminding voice to the learning sub lamp 100.
The learning sub-lamp 100 further includes: and the voice playing module 170 is configured to receive and play the reminding voice to remind the person under guardianship to learn.
Specifically, the learning sub-lamp can play the reminding voice through the voice playing module after receiving the reminding voice sent by the monitoring main lamp, and timely reminds children to learn seriously.
